jquery - 如何使用 jQuery.add()?

标签 jquery

我就是看不懂,这个功能是什么add()用于。

当我阅读文档时,例如一段代码

<p>Hello</p>
<span>Hello Again</span>

$( "p" ).add( "span" ).css( "background", "yellow" );

可以更容易地完成,就像这样,不是吗?

$( "p, span" ).css( "background", "yellow" );

最佳答案

嗨,jquery add() 函数 actullay 执行将元素添加到匹配元素集合中的操作。

就像你的情况一样..

$( "p" ).add( "span" ).css( "background", "yellow" );

将跨度添加到所有 p 元素,跨度背景为黄色。我还添加了一个 fiddle 来解释。 http://jsbin.com/ENufeNu/1/edit

关于jquery - 如何使用 jQuery.add()?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19859855/

相关文章:

javascript - 将 Pikachoose 设置为仅显示缩略图

jquery - unbind ('click' ) 是否会删除 onclick?

jquery:鼠标悬停加载状态

javascript - 限制DatePicker选择的最小年份

jquery - 函数 'has' 无法处理使用 jQuery 加载的数据

jquery - Jqplot:附加右对齐文本和堆栈圆环图

javascript - 具有需要切换 jQuery 的隐藏行的表

javascript - 如何检查ajax响应中的选项?

php - 获取 div 值的最佳方法是什么?

javascript - ASP MVC 刷新部分 View 网格